| Learning outcomes |
|
The second-year student's clinical practise. Students apply the learned theoretical knowledge into a practice. The practice takes place in the rehabilitation workplaces of the R.R.R. center in Olomouc, inpatient departments of the University Hospital in Olomouc, inpatient departments and outpatients of the Military Hospital in Olomouc, in the outpatient workplace of the Policlinic AGEL in Olomouc, as well as in Jitrocel Olomouc, FyzioMed, s.r.o. and in Spas Slatinice. Subject Clinical practice 2 follows the subject Clinical practice 1.

| Assessment methods and criteria |
|
Student performance, Systematic Observation of Student
Credit Requirements: 100% attendance at all clinical placements, a completed, defended, and signed medical record from University Hospital Olomouc (FNOL) and RRR, and a completed, defended, and signed case report. Required Tools: Goniometer, neurological hammer, measuring tape, writing utensils. The student must be dressed in medical clothing and footwear (i.e., white shirt/t-shirt, white trousers, white or light blue sweatshirt/vest) and must carry an identification card. Students are divided into six groups (A, B, C, D, E, F), which are binding throughout the entire semester and determine the specific schedule of clinical placements at individual departments. The student is required to be both theoretically and practically prepared for the placement based on the knowledge acquired during previous studies. If it is found that the student is not prepared, the clinical supervisor may refuse to recognize the placement for that day, and the student must make up for it. If the placement is not recognized on two occasions within one semester, the student will be required to repeat the entire course in the following academic year. |
